CC -!- FUNCTION: Involved in the biosynthesis of glycosaminoglycans;
CC hyaluronan, chondroitin sulfate, and heparan sulfate.
CC {ECO:0000256|PIRNR:PIRNR000124}.
CC -!- CATALYTIC ACTIVITY:
CC Reaction=H2O + 2 NAD(+) + UDP-alpha-D-glucose = 3 H(+) + 2 NADH + UDP-
CC alpha-D-glucuronate; Xref=Rhea:RHEA:23596, ChEBI:CHEBI:15377,
CC ChEBI:CHEBI:15378, ChEBI:CHEBI:57540, ChEBI:CHEBI:57945,
CC ChEBI:CHEBI:58052, ChEBI:CHEBI:58885; EC=1.1.1.22;
CC Evidence={ECO:0000256|ARBA:ARBA00000874,
CC ECO:0000256|PIRNR:PIRNR000124};
CC -!- PATHWAY: Nucleotide-sugar biosynthesis; UDP-alpha-D-glucuronate
CC biosynthesis; UDP-alpha-D-glucuronate from UDP-alpha-D-glucose: step
CC 1/1. {ECO:0000256|ARBA:ARBA00004701}.
CC -!- SIMILARITY: Belongs to the UDP-glucose/GDP-mannose dehydrogenase
CC family. {ECO:0000256|ARBA:ARBA00006601, ECO:0000256|PIRNR:PIRNR000124}.
